Transaction 84963933923b825a764fe2fdeccdea5d27d1067a4850e8bfa3b09ca386957921
1 Input
1 Output
-
84963933923b825a764fe2fdeccdea5d27d1067a4850e8bfa3b09ca386957921:0
- value
- 1328794
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03aac9c457565b763cbefa8d381b17dfb97d0251 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Pd9NZNopyPerkYp5rit5n6UiYRswySm